Exemple #1
0
        private void toolStripButton4_Click(object sender, EventArgs e)
        {
            //AraçHareketleri
            try
            {
                DataSet    ds        = new DataSet();
                int        secılenıd = SecilenArabaID = Convert.ToInt32((dataGridView1.Rows[dataGridView1.CurrentRow.Index].Cells[0].Value).ToString());
                string     sorgu     = "select A.PLAKA_NO,M.TC_NO,M.ADI,M.SOYADI,K.ALIS_TARIHI,K.TESLIM_TARIHI,K.KIRA_TOPLAM_TUTAR from ARABALAR A,KIRALAMA_EMRI K,MUSTERI M,MARKALAR MA,MODEL MO,SERI SE where A.ARABA_ID=K.ARABA_ID and K.MUSTERI_ID=M.MUSTERI_ID and MA.MARKA_ID=A.MARKA_ID and MO.MODEL_ID=A.MODEL_ID and SE.SERI_ID=A.SERI_ID and A.ARABA_ID=" + secılenıd;
                VeriTabani vt        = new VeriTabani();
                ds = vt.SorguCekDataSetGonder(sorgu, "ARABALAR");
                if (ds.Tables[0].Rows.Count > 0)
                {
                    vt.ExcellDoldur(ds, "ARABALAR");
                }
                else
                {
                    MessageBox.Show("Seçilen Arabanın Hareketi Bulunmamaktadır !!!", "BİLGİ", MessageBoxButtons.OK, MessageBoxIcon.Information);
                }

                //TümListe();
            }
            catch (Exception)
            {
                MessageBox.Show("Listeden Kayıt Seçiniz !!!", "UYARI", MessageBoxButtons.OK, MessageBoxIcon.Warning);
            }
        }
Exemple #2
0
        private void MusteriGuncelle_Load(object sender, EventArgs e)
        {
            VeriTabani vt = new VeriTabani();
            DataSet    ds = vt.MusteriGonder(Gelen_ID);

            vt.ExcellDoldur(ds, "Deneme");
            textTc.Text       = ds.Tables[0].Rows[0].ItemArray[1].ToString();
            textAd.Text       = ds.Tables[0].Rows[0].ItemArray[2].ToString();
            textSoyad.Text    = ds.Tables[0].Rows[0].ItemArray[3].ToString();
            textDogumTar.Text = Convert.ToDateTime(ds.Tables[0].Rows[0].ItemArray[4].ToString()).ToShortDateString();
            textTel.Text      = ds.Tables[0].Rows[0].ItemArray[6].ToString();
            textEmail.Text    = ds.Tables[0].Rows[0].ItemArray[7].ToString();
            textAdres.Text    = ds.Tables[0].Rows[0].ItemArray[5].ToString();
        }
Exemple #3
0
        private void toolStripMenuItem2_Click(object sender, EventArgs e)
        {
            DateTime bas       = Convert.ToDateTime(k.InputBox("Başlangıç Tarihini Giriniz ? ", "Başlangıç Tarihi", DateTime.Now.ToShortDateString()));
            DateTime bit       = Convert.ToDateTime(k.InputBox("Bitiş Tarihini Giriniz ? ", "Bitiş Tarihi", DateTime.Now.ToShortDateString()));
            string   baslangıc = bas.ToString("yyyy-MM-dd HH:mm:ss.FFF");
            string   bitis     = bit.ToString("yyyy-MM-dd HH:mm:ss.FFF");

            string     sorgu = "select A.PLAKA_NO,M.TC_NO,M.ADI,M.SOYADI,K.ALIS_TARIHI,K.TESLIM_TARIHI,K.KIRA_TOPLAM_TUTAR from ARABALAR A,KIRALAMA_EMRI K,MUSTERI M,MARKALAR MA,MODEL MO,SERI SE where A.ARABA_ID=K.ARABA_ID and K.MUSTERI_ID=M.MUSTERI_ID and MA.MARKA_ID=A.MARKA_ID and MO.MODEL_ID=A.MODEL_ID and SE.SERI_ID=A.SERI_ID and  K.TESLIM_TARIHI>='" + baslangıc + "' and K.TESLIM_TARIHI <='" + bitis + "'";
            VeriTabani vt    = new VeriTabani();
            DataSet    ds    = new DataSet();

            ds = vt.SorguCekDataSetGonder(sorgu, "ARABA");
            if (ds.Tables[0].Rows.Count == 0)
            {
                MessageBox.Show("Seçilen Tarihlerde Hareket Bulunmamaktadır !!!", "BİLGİ", MessageBoxButtons.OK, MessageBoxIcon.Information);
            }
            else
            {
                vt.ExcellDoldur(ds, "ARABA");
            }
        }
Exemple #4
0
        private void button1_Click(object sender, EventArgs e)
        {
            string bas = dateTimeBas.Value.ToString("yyyy-MM-dd HH:mm:ss.FFF");
            string bit = dateTimeBitis.Value.ToString("yyyy-MM-dd HH:mm:ss.FFF");

            if (checkplaka.Checked && checkTarih.Checked)
            {
                // string a = "select * from satislar where tarih>='" + datetimepicker1.text + "' and tarih<='" + datetimepicker2.text + "'";
                string     sorgu = "select A.PLAKA_NO,M.TC_NO,M.ADI,M.SOYADI,K.ALIS_TARIHI,K.TESLIM_TARIHI,K.KIRA_TOPLAM_TUTAR from ARABALAR A,KIRALAMA_EMRI K,MUSTERI M,MARKALAR MA,MODEL MO,SERI SE where A.ARABA_ID=K.ARABA_ID and K.MUSTERI_ID=M.MUSTERI_ID and MA.MARKA_ID=A.MARKA_ID and MO.MODEL_ID=A.MODEL_ID and SE.SERI_ID=A.SERI_ID and A.PLAKA_NO='" + TextPlakaArama.Text + "' and K.TESLIM_TARIHI>='" + bas + "' and K.TESLIM_TARIHI <='" + bit + "'";
                VeriTabani vt    = new VeriTabani();
                DataSet    ds    = new DataSet();
                ds = vt.SorguCekDataSetGonder(sorgu, "ARABA");
                if (ds.Tables[0].Rows.Count == 0)
                {
                    MessageBox.Show("Seçilen Arabanın Hareketi Bulunmamaktadır !!!", "BİLGİ", MessageBoxButtons.OK, MessageBoxIcon.Information);
                }
                else
                {
                    vt.ExcellDoldur(ds, "ARABA");
                }
            }
            else if (checkMarka.Checked && checkTarih.Checked)
            {
                string sorgu = "";
                if (MARKA != 0 && MODEL != 0 && SERI != 0)
                {
                    sorgu = "select A.PLAKA_NO,M.TC_NO,M.ADI,M.SOYADI,K.ALIS_TARIHI,K.TESLIM_TARIHI,K.KIRA_TOPLAM_TUTAR from ARABALAR A,KIRALAMA_EMRI K,MUSTERI M,MARKALAR MA,MODEL MO,SERI SE where A.ARABA_ID=K.ARABA_ID and K.MUSTERI_ID=M.MUSTERI_ID and MA.MARKA_ID=A.MARKA_ID and MO.MODEL_ID=A.MODEL_ID and SE.SERI_ID=A.SERI_ID and  K.TESLIM_TARIHI>='" + bas + "' and K.TESLIM_TARIHI <='" + bit + "' and (MA.MARKA_ID=" + MARKA_ID[comboMarka.SelectedIndex] + " and MO.MODEL_ID=" + MODEL_ID[comboModel.SelectedIndex] + " and SE.SERI_ID=" + SERI_ID[comboSeri.SelectedIndex] + ")";
                }
                else if (MARKA != 0 && MODEL != 0)
                {
                    sorgu = "select A.PLAKA_NO,M.TC_NO,M.ADI,M.SOYADI,K.ALIS_TARIHI,K.TESLIM_TARIHI,K.KIRA_TOPLAM_TUTAR from ARABALAR A,KIRALAMA_EMRI K,MUSTERI M,MARKALAR MA,MODEL MO,SERI SE where A.ARABA_ID=K.ARABA_ID and K.MUSTERI_ID=M.MUSTERI_ID and MA.MARKA_ID=A.MARKA_ID and MO.MODEL_ID=A.MODEL_ID and SE.SERI_ID=A.SERI_ID and  K.TESLIM_TARIHI>='" + bas + "' and K.TESLIM_TARIHI <='" + bit + "' and (MA.MARKA_ID=" + MARKA_ID[comboMarka.SelectedIndex] + " and MO.MODEL_ID=" + MODEL_ID[comboModel.SelectedIndex] + ")";
                }
                else if (MARKA != 0)
                {
                    sorgu = "select A.PLAKA_NO,M.TC_NO,M.ADI,M.SOYADI,K.ALIS_TARIHI,K.TESLIM_TARIHI,K.KIRA_TOPLAM_TUTAR from ARABALAR A,KIRALAMA_EMRI K,MUSTERI M,MARKALAR MA,MODEL MO,SERI SE where A.ARABA_ID=K.ARABA_ID and K.MUSTERI_ID=M.MUSTERI_ID and MA.MARKA_ID=A.MARKA_ID and MO.MODEL_ID=A.MODEL_ID and SE.SERI_ID=A.SERI_ID and  K.TESLIM_TARIHI>='" + bas + "' and K.TESLIM_TARIHI <='" + bit + "' and (MA.MARKA_ID=" + MARKA_ID[comboMarka.SelectedIndex] + ")";
                }
                else if (MARKA == 0)
                {
                    MessageBox.Show("Listeden Kayıt Seçiniz !!", "HATA", MessageBoxButtons.OK, MessageBoxIcon.Error);
                    return;
                }

                VeriTabani vt = new VeriTabani();
                DataSet    ds = new DataSet();
                ds = vt.SorguCekDataSetGonder(sorgu, "ARABA");
                if (ds.Tables[0].Rows.Count == 0)
                {
                    MessageBox.Show("Seçilen Arabanın Hareketi Bulunmamaktadır !!!", "BİLGİ", MessageBoxButtons.OK, MessageBoxIcon.Information);
                }
                else
                {
                    vt.ExcellDoldur(ds, "ARABA");
                }
            }
            else if (checkTarih.Checked)
            {
                string     sorgu = "select A.PLAKA_NO,M.TC_NO,M.ADI,M.SOYADI,K.ALIS_TARIHI,K.TESLIM_TARIHI,K.KIRA_TOPLAM_TUTAR from ARABALAR A,KIRALAMA_EMRI K,MUSTERI M,MARKALAR MA,MODEL MO,SERI SE where A.ARABA_ID=K.ARABA_ID and K.MUSTERI_ID=M.MUSTERI_ID and MA.MARKA_ID=A.MARKA_ID and MO.MODEL_ID=A.MODEL_ID and SE.SERI_ID=A.SERI_ID and  K.TESLIM_TARIHI>='" + bas + "' and K.TESLIM_TARIHI <='" + bit + "'";
                VeriTabani vt    = new VeriTabani();
                DataSet    ds    = new DataSet();
                ds = vt.SorguCekDataSetGonder(sorgu, "ARABA");
                if (ds.Tables[0].Rows.Count == 0)
                {
                    MessageBox.Show("Seçilen Tarihlerde Hareket Bulunmamaktadır !!!", "BİLGİ", MessageBoxButtons.OK, MessageBoxIcon.Information);
                }
                else
                {
                    vt.ExcellDoldur(ds, "ARABA");
                }
            }
            else if (checkplaka.Checked)
            {
                // string a = "select * from satislar where tarih>='" + datetimepicker1.text + "' and tarih<='" + datetimepicker2.text + "'";
                string     sorgu = "select A.PLAKA_NO,M.TC_NO,M.ADI,M.SOYADI,K.ALIS_TARIHI,K.TESLIM_TARIHI,K.KIRA_TOPLAM_TUTAR from ARABALAR A,KIRALAMA_EMRI K,MUSTERI M,MARKALAR MA,MODEL MO,SERI SE where A.ARABA_ID=K.ARABA_ID and K.MUSTERI_ID=M.MUSTERI_ID and MA.MARKA_ID=A.MARKA_ID and MO.MODEL_ID=A.MODEL_ID and SE.SERI_ID=A.SERI_ID and A.PLAKA_NO='" + TextPlakaArama.Text + "'";
                VeriTabani vt    = new VeriTabani();
                DataSet    ds    = new DataSet();
                ds = vt.SorguCekDataSetGonder(sorgu, "ARABA");
                if (ds.Tables[0].Rows.Count == 0)
                {
                    MessageBox.Show("Seçilen Arabanın Hareketi Bulunmamaktadır !!!", "BİLGİ", MessageBoxButtons.OK, MessageBoxIcon.Information);
                }
                else
                {
                    vt.ExcellDoldur(ds, "ARABA");
                }
            }
            else if (checkMarka.Checked)
            {
                string sorgu = "";
                if (MARKA != 0 && MODEL != 0 && SERI != 0)
                {
                    sorgu = "select A.PLAKA_NO,M.TC_NO,M.ADI,M.SOYADI,K.ALIS_TARIHI,K.TESLIM_TARIHI,K.KIRA_TOPLAM_TUTAR from ARABALAR A,KIRALAMA_EMRI K,MUSTERI M,MARKALAR MA,MODEL MO,SERI SE where A.ARABA_ID=K.ARABA_ID and K.MUSTERI_ID=M.MUSTERI_ID and MA.MARKA_ID=A.MARKA_ID and MO.MODEL_ID=A.MODEL_ID and SE.SERI_ID=A.SERI_ID and (MA.MARKA_ID=" + MARKA_ID[comboMarka.SelectedIndex] + " and MO.MODEL_ID=" + MODEL_ID[comboModel.SelectedIndex] + " and SE.SERI_ID=" + SERI_ID[comboSeri.SelectedIndex] + ")";
                }
                else if (MARKA != 0 && MODEL != 0)
                {
                    sorgu = "select A.PLAKA_NO,M.TC_NO,M.ADI,M.SOYADI,K.ALIS_TARIHI,K.TESLIM_TARIHI,K.KIRA_TOPLAM_TUTAR from ARABALAR A,KIRALAMA_EMRI K,MUSTERI M,MARKALAR MA,MODEL MO,SERI SE where A.ARABA_ID=K.ARABA_ID and K.MUSTERI_ID=M.MUSTERI_ID and MA.MARKA_ID=A.MARKA_ID and MO.MODEL_ID=A.MODEL_ID and SE.SERI_ID=A.SERI_ID and  (MA.MARKA_ID=" + MARKA_ID[comboMarka.SelectedIndex] + " and MO.MODEL_ID=" + MODEL_ID[comboModel.SelectedIndex] + ")";
                }
                else if (MARKA != 0)
                {
                    sorgu = "select A.PLAKA_NO,M.TC_NO,M.ADI,M.SOYADI,K.ALIS_TARIHI,K.TESLIM_TARIHI,K.KIRA_TOPLAM_TUTAR from ARABALAR A,KIRALAMA_EMRI K,MUSTERI M,MARKALAR MA,MODEL MO,SERI SE where A.ARABA_ID=K.ARABA_ID and K.MUSTERI_ID=M.MUSTERI_ID and MA.MARKA_ID=A.MARKA_ID and MO.MODEL_ID=A.MODEL_ID and SE.SERI_ID=A.SERI_ID  and (MA.MARKA_ID=" + MARKA_ID[comboMarka.SelectedIndex] + ")";
                }
                else if (MARKA == 0)
                {
                    MessageBox.Show("Listeden Kayıt Seçiniz !!", "HATA", MessageBoxButtons.OK, MessageBoxIcon.Error);
                    return;
                }

                VeriTabani vt = new VeriTabani();
                DataSet    ds = new DataSet();
                ds = vt.SorguCekDataSetGonder(sorgu, "ARABA");
                if (ds.Tables[0].Rows.Count == 0)
                {
                    MessageBox.Show("Seçilen Arabanın Hareketi Bulunmamaktadır !!!", "BİLGİ", MessageBoxButtons.OK, MessageBoxIcon.Information);
                }
                else
                {
                    vt.ExcellDoldur(ds, "ARABA");
                }
            }
            else
            {
                // string a = "select * from satislar where tarih>='" + datetimepicker1.text + "' and tarih<='" + datetimepicker2.text + "'";
                string     sorgu = "select A.PLAKA_NO,M.TC_NO,M.ADI,M.SOYADI,K.ALIS_TARIHI,K.TESLIM_TARIHI,K.KIRA_TOPLAM_TUTAR from ARABALAR A,KIRALAMA_EMRI K,MUSTERI M,MARKALAR MA,MODEL MO,SERI SE where A.ARABA_ID=K.ARABA_ID and K.MUSTERI_ID=M.MUSTERI_ID and MA.MARKA_ID=A.MARKA_ID and MO.MODEL_ID=A.MODEL_ID and SE.SERI_ID=A.SERI_ID";
                VeriTabani vt    = new VeriTabani();
                DataSet    ds    = new DataSet();
                ds = vt.SorguCekDataSetGonder(sorgu, "ARABA");
                if (ds.Tables[0].Rows.Count == 0)
                {
                    MessageBox.Show("Seçilen Arabanın Hareketi Bulunmamaktadır !!!", "BİLGİ", MessageBoxButtons.OK, MessageBoxIcon.Information);
                }
                else
                {
                    vt.ExcellDoldur(ds, "ARABA");
                }
            }
        }